2012-02-09 63 views
0

我正在開發Spotify平臺上的第三方應用程序。 因此,用戶必須選擇他自己的圖書館或必須選擇spotify圖書館。 所以,我試圖尋找特定藝術家流派 我有下面的代碼卡用戶庫和Spotify庫,搜索特定藝術家或流派的Spotify和用戶音樂庫

變種搜索=新models.Search(「阿肯」);

search.localResults = models.LOCALSEARCHRESULTS.APPEND; 

search.observe(models.EVENT.CHANGE, function() { 

    search.artists.forEach(function(artist) { 

     console.log(artist.name); 

    }); 

}); 

search.appendNext(); 

但我得到以下錯誤,

遺漏的類型錯誤:無法讀取未定義 遺漏的類型錯誤的特性「追加」:對象#有沒有方法「觀察」

的是,有函數搜索用戶庫和spotify庫的特定類型和藝術家 或我必須使用任何第三方庫這種類型的功能。 如果是這樣,那麼建議我提供任何提供此類功能的第三方庫。 謝謝。

回答

0

確保您使用最新的預覽版本(可在此處獲得:http://developer.spotify.com/en/spotify-apps-api/preview/) - 這就是爲什麼您會收到錯誤。

對於使用搜索時,看到這裏的文檔:http://developer.spotify.com/download/spotify-apps-api/preview/reference/833e3a06d6.html

最後,有沒有辦法「搜索」用戶的庫以外通過在library.albumslibrary.artistslibrary.tracks方法的項目循環。再次看到文檔。

+0

請你可以告訴我,如果我只想搜索spotify庫爲特定的藝術家或流派,以及爲什麼我在上面的代碼snipet錯誤。我從spotify最新的api中拿到了同樣的東西。謝謝。 – Sam 2012-02-10 05:22:35

+0

獲得最新的預覽版本搜索功能正在工作。謝謝iKenndac。 – Sam 2012-02-10 11:08:26

+0

不要重複寫下東西。文字留在那裏,它不像「說些什麼」! – eyurdakul 2012-03-22 14:22:36

相關問題